Output 98d5bfa3300edd424a84ee4605debb02a9c246fb991d7c4a557c13a3b20742fb:56

value
68954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bdb3566d67ed9ad60dfad9bc3a7bc2f08e22051 OP_EQUAL
address
379WPk1RYwwtF6oiY8at3BMMbA13LSX32x
transaction
98d5bfa3300edd424a84ee4605debb02a9c246fb991d7c4a557c13a3b20742fb
spent
true